		<description><![CDATA[With a title like &#8220;The Parsifal Mosaic&#8221;, you know it has to be a pretty sophisticated spy thriller. Or a very bad, unsophisticated spy thriller with a sophisticated spy thriller sounding title. Either way, Ron Howard is going to be directing the movie, based on yet another novel by the master of the spy thriller novels himself Robert Ludlum for Universal Pictures. This is, officially, spy novel number #1,009 from the Ludlum library that is currently being developed in Hollywood at the moment. Oh, Jason Bourne, you and your gazillion dollar box office take. See what you&#8217;ve done?
Originally published in 1982, &#8220;The Parsifal Mosaic&#8221; follows a veteran U.S. intelligence agent who believes he has just witnessed the murder of his lover, an accused Russian double spy.
